Michelle Collins Anderson
Michelle Collins Anderson is the USA Today bestselling author of The Flower Sisters. She grew up on a farm in the Missouri Ozarks—a place and a way of life that have shaped her writing. A graduate of the University of Missouri, with a MFA from Warren Wilson College, she previously worked in advertising and public relations, taught elementary school creative writing, and was an adjunct professor at the University of Missouri and Stephens College. She serves on the board of The Missouri Review and her Pushcart Prize-nominated short fiction has appeared in Nimrod International Journal, Literal Latté, Midwestern Gothic, Elder Mountain: A Journal of Ozarks Studies, Bosque, The Lascaux Review, Pooled Ink, Storied Hills: An Anthology of Contemporary Ozark Fiction, and other publications. She and her husband have three children and live in St. Louis, Missouri. She can be found online at MichelleAnderson.me.
